Fantasy Football Implications: The Next Wave of Stars
For fantasy managers, the key is to look beyond the established veterans and identify the players poised for a breakout. This requires a blend of scouting, understanding team needs, and recognizing coaching tendencies. Are there teams with aging stars at key positions? Are there offensive schemes that are particularly conducive to fantasy production? These are the questions that separate the casual player from the serious contender.
We’ve seen countless examples of rookies who, with the right possibility and talent, can become fantasy league winners.Think back to the immediate impact of players like Justin Jefferson or Ja’Marr Chase. Their ability to step into a starting role and produce at an elite level was a testament to their talent and the systems they were placed in. The challenge for fantasy managers is to identify the next wave before they become household names.
However, it’s crucial to temper expectations. Not every highly touted prospect will live up to the hype. Injuries, scheme fits, and simply the brutal competition of the NFL can derail even the most promising careers. This is where the art of fantasy football truly shines – navigating the uncertainty and making calculated risks.
